Williams makes it to 400m final by a whisker
World Youth Silver medallist, 18-year-old Daniel Williams was a hair away from not making the final of the boy’s under-20 400m final at the ongoing Carifta Games being held in The Bahamas.
Competing today, the talented quarter miler Guyanese finished fourth in heat three of the event with a time of 48.18s.
Williams’ time was the slowest qualifying time with Jonathan Jones of Barbados winning the heat in 47.46s.
While the time of Williams might suggest a bit of a struggle for the top athlete, it is known that he is a big games performer; a testament to his success at the World Youth Championships last year where he qualified for the final because an athlete was disqualified for a lane infringement. The rest is history.
Nevertheless, Williams will have the opportunity to add more medals to his cabinet later today when he contests the final.
